1. Max Brenner

Located at 841 Broadway, this chocolate lover’s dream is a restaurant you can’t miss! I have eaten here before and thoroughly enjoyed my meal. Let’s be real — they have regular food, but we all just want the chocolate! In fact, there are vats of chocolate on display in the restaurant! The fondue special is awesome and the liquid chocolate to drink is actually liquid heaven. Chocolate lovers, look no further!

3. The Sugar Factory

This fairly new restaurant located in the Meatpacking District has sweet treats and drinks that will blow your mind. I’m sure you’ve all seen that signature green drink on your news feed!

5. Eataly

This Italian restaurant is located right on 5th Avenue. As many know, this avenue is one of style and luxury, so you may pay a little more for your meal. However, the pasta dishes there look heavenly!

7. Artichoke Basille’s Pizza

This well-known pizza parlor has locations dotting NYC! The slices are huge and decadently flavored. Supposedly, their secret sauce with more than 20 ingredients is what makes this artichoke pizza one for the books!
